💨 Abstract
The NTT R&D Forum in Tokyo showcased advancements in technology, including the world's first Optical Quantum Computer experiment. Professor Akira Furusawa demonstrated the computer's ability to operate between two distant locations. Takuya Kanda presented brainwave technology that allows control of avatars and wheelchairs, and NTT's sensor technology for enhancing golfing experiences.
